drm/imagination: Implement job submission and scheduling Implement job submission ioctl. Job scheduling is implemented using drm_sched. Jobs are submitted in a stream format. This is intended to allow the UAPI data format to be independent of the actual FWIF structures in use, which vary depending on the GPU in use. drm/imagination: Implement firmware infrastructure and META FW support The infrastructure includes parsing of the firmware image, initialising FW-side structures, handling the kernel and firmware command ringbuffers and starting & stopping the firmware processor. This patch also adds the necessary support code for the META firmware processor. drm/imagination: Implement power management Add power management to the driver, using runtime pm. The power off sequence depends on firmware commands which are not implemented in this patch.
